Ballet
Kimberly began dancing at age 2 1/2 and by age 8, she began to focus solely on classical ballet and trained with the California Ballet Ensemble and Fallbrook Ballet. At 14, Kimberly was accepted to the DanceAspen summer camp and trained with Jillana of the NYC Ballet. She also trained and traveled with the Phoenix School of Ballet and Ballet Etudes in Chandler. She has performed at a Phoenix Suns game, multiple galas, demonstrations and ballets, including The Nutcracker, Serenade, Dracula, and A Mid-Summer Night's Dream. She began teaching ballet at age 14 and went on to dance at The University of Arizona and teach at Creative Dance Arts in Tucson. She is also a Registered Nurse in the Neonatal ICU.
